WebMar 13, 2024 · In general, a myopathy does not appear to be a typical manifestation of toxoplasmosis in cats. 2,20 In contrast, myopathy is frequently associated with toxoplasmosis in dogs. Evans et al 8 detected positive serological T gondii titres in 16/51 dogs diagnosed with inflammatory myopathy, five of which recovered fully with … WebClindamycin (brand names Antirobe®, Cleocin®, ClinDrops®, Clintabs®) is an antibiotic used to treat a range of bacterial infections in dogs and cats. WebToxoplasmosis is an infection caused by a single-celled organism, Toxoplasma gondii, capable of infecting both dog and owner alike. The infection is spread either through the feces of infected cats (as sporozoites) or undercooked meat (as tissue cysts). ... Antirobe (clindamycin) is the treatment of choice for toxoplasmosis in dogs and should ...

WebClindamycin is the drug of choice for treating clinical toxoplasmosis in dogs and cats.
